GAME INFO
Rev up your engines in Street Car Racing as you drift through the city streets, feeling the adrenaline of fast-paced races. Master tight corners, collect nitro boosts for explosive speed, and customize your ride to outmaneuver rivals. Hit the open road and explore a thrilling urban playground!
DO YOU LIKE THIS GAME?
Embed this game